This firmware used to booting up device though usb (sunxi-fel)
This routine used to do things like:
1) Write Uboot Kernel Rootfs into memory and start
2) in kernel, simulate SPI NAND as a usb mass storage device
so you can come to the pc side, use `dd` command to program the flash

When you program the flash, you better split the file into servral pieces, like 128MB to 16 x 8MB like this:
# A 8MB window loop
# 1 block = 512 byte
sudo dd if=firmware.bin of=/dev/sda skip=0 count=16384
sudo dd if=firmware.bin of=/dev/sda skip=16384 count=37268
a full dd write may cause OOM problem because the kernel buff/cache
feature.
